NOTES AND MEMORANDA.

Miss C. W. Christie will lecture on "The Religious and Social Lifn of the Indian People" in tho Scottish Society's rooms to-night. Tho annual meeting fif the Chrisfcchurch Homing Pigeon Society will be held to-night in the Terminus"Hotel. To-morrow evening in the Choral Hall a free popular lecture, arranged by tho Navy League, wili bo given by Mr Henry J. Marrinor on "The Foreign Policy of Germany and her Army and Navy." The Rifle Club's concert in tho Motukarara Hall has been postponed till September Ist. Mrs Harrison Lee-Cowie will speak in Cathedral Square at 12.30 p.m. today and at 7.30 n.m. this evening in the Orange Hall, Hornby. On the 7th inst.
